**Ticket: Zero-downtime migration stalled on orders table**

The Tidegate migration runner paused mid-backfill on the orders table during last night's window. Reads and writes continued normally (dual-write mode held), but the backfill cursor has not advanced in six hours. Support may see customers reporting stale order-status values until the backfill completes. Do not retry the migration manually; the runner resumes from its checkpoint. If customers escalate, reference the migration job and the build token printed below.

build token for kagaf-hahof: htk14_9d3d4d26d7d8de

**14:22 UTC** — On-call confirmed that the Brindlewharf parcel-tracking webhook began rejecting signed payloads after the certificate rotation at 14:07. Retries from the Ostermere courier feed piled up in the dead-letter queue, roughly 4,100 events. Mitigation: rolled the receiver back to the prior signing bundle and replayed the queue in batches of 500. Replay completed at 14:58 with zero losses. The trace token for the replay run is recorded below.

trace token, fafog-kageg: htk4_98e6

TURN-208: Gatevale turnstile counters at the Merrow Field pilot double-count when a rotation reverses mid-cycle. Attendance totals drift roughly 2% high per event. The debounce window fix is implemented, reviewed by Ilsa, and soak-tested across two simulated match days without drift. Ready for your cut; the candidate build is identified below.

trace token, tagag-tafog: htk6_5ed18c